Willa Hahn, 69

Willa Dean Hahn, age 69, of Sturgis, Michigan passed away Monday morning, July 4, 2011 at the Sturgis Hospital Emergency Room.

She was born October 11, 1941 in Sandy Hook, Kentucky a daughter of Lee and Dessie (Frailey) Conley.

Willa Dean had resided in Sturgis for the past 47 years coming from Moorhead, Kentucky.

On January 26, 1980 she married Earl Hahn in Sturgis.

She was a dedicated wife and mother and had been employed at Grumman Olson, Sunny & Sons Gas Station and Transogram in Sturgis. She also did some waitressing.

Willa was a member of the First Baptist Church in Sturgis and was a past president of the Eagles Auxiliary Lodge #1314. She enjoyed crafts, flower gardening and Facebook.

She is survived by her loving and dedicated husband, Earl, six daughters, Paula (Tim) Doenges of Colon, Vicky Barrons of Sturgis, Debra (John) Gorman of Waukee, Iowa, Laura (Marty) Barnard of Sturgis, Susan (Rodney) Taylor of Mendon and Kathy (Stephen) McPherson of Port Huron, two sons, Paul Winkleman of Three Rivers and Kevin Hahn of Colon, 24 grandchildren, 22 great grandchildren, her mother, Dessie Conley of Flemingsburg, Kentucky, four sisters, four brothers and many nieces and nephews.

She was preceded in death by her father, one son, Norman Winkleman, one daughter, Brenda Winkleman, grandson, Brian Hahn, one brother and one sister.
